Insurance stocks swings up

Friday, July 3, 2009 3:06 pm
By ShareGyan.com NewsDesk

Bajaj Finserv, Reliance Capital, ICICI Bank, State Bank of India, Aditya Birla Nuvo rushed up.
Nevertheless, Max India was low with 1.71%.
The yearly Economic Survey given by the finance ministry in Parliament on Thursday suggested a growth in the insurance sector in foreign direct investment limit to 49% from 26% at present.
Aditya Birla Nuvo owns 74% in Birla Sun Life Insurance Company. Reliance Capital owns 100% in Reliance Life Insurance. Bajaj Finserv owns 74% in Bajaj Allianz General Insurance. ICICI Bank owns 74% in the ICICI Prudential Life Insurance Company. State Bank of India owns 74% in the SBI Life Insurance Company.
